跳转到主要内容
完成以下四个步骤,开始使用 OneSignal 发送已认证的邮件。整个过程约需 10 分钟,加上最多 24 个工作小时的账户验证时间。
Diagram showing the email setup steps: provider, sender, DNS, and verification

1. 选择提供商

在您的 OneSignal 仪表板中,导航到 Settings > Email > Set up Email,然后点击 Continue Setup 以使用 OneSignal 邮件。
Email configuration page showing provider options
OneSignal 还支持外部提供商:SendGridMailgunMailchimp

2. 创建发送者

配置默认发送者身份,OneSignal 将使用该身份从您的域名发送已认证的邮件:
  • Default sender email — 未指定其他发送者时使用的邮箱地址。
  • Default sender name — 显示在收件人收件箱中的显示名称(例如 Acme Team)。
  • Default reply-to — 用户回复时的邮箱地址。您可以为每封邮件单独覆盖此设置。
  • Sending domain — OneSignal 会根据您的发送者邮箱自动生成子域名,您可以对其进行自定义。
Form fields for default sender email, name, reply-to, and sending domain
为了获得最佳送达性,请使用子域名(例如 mail.yourdomain.com),而不是您的根域名。

发送者

添加和管理多个发送者、发件人地址、回复地址和发送域名。

3. 配置 DNS

配置 DNS 记录以认证您的发送域名。您可以使用域名注册商登录信息进行自动配置(如果您的注册商受支持),或手动添加记录。 在 DNS 配置视图中,警告图标表示记录不匹配,对勾图标表示记录匹配。
OneSignal dashboard showing required DNS records and their verification status

邮件 DNS 配置

自动配置或手动添加 SPF、DKIM 和 DMARC 记录的分步指南。

4. 验证您的账户

DNS 配置完成后,点击 Verify 开启支持工单。系统会询问您的公司信息和预期使用场景。
OneSignal account verification dialog with form fields
  • 提供完整的答案以加快审批速度。
  • 支持团队通常在 24 个工作小时内回复。
  • 验证完成后您会收到一封邮件通知。
  • 在等待审批期间,您可以发送测试邮件。

设置完成后

账户验证通过后,您即可开始发送邮件。

常见问题

账户验证需要多长时间?

OneSignal 支持团队通常在 24 个工作小时内回复。在等待验证完成期间,您可以发送测试邮件。

什么是子域名?为什么应该使用子域名?

子域名是添加到域名前的前缀——例如,mail.yourdomain.comyourdomain.com 的子域名。您的”发件人地址”仍然可以显示为 anything@yourdomain.com,而子域名则用于邮件身份验证和投递。
Diagram showing the difference between the from domain and from address
使用子域名可以将邮件发送声誉与根域名隔离。如果您的营销邮件产生了投诉,不会影响根域名在其他服务(如企业邮件)中的声誉。您还可以为不同的邮件流维护独立的声誉:
  • mail.yourdomain.com 用于营销邮件
  • receipts.yourdomain.com 用于交易邮件

需要哪些 DNS 记录?

OneSignal 需要 SPF、DKIM 和 DMARC 记录来认证您的发送域名。具体值会在设置过程中显示在 OneSignal 仪表板中。详情请参阅邮件 DNS 配置

我可以使用外部邮件提供商代替 OneSignal 邮件吗?

可以。OneSignal 支持 SendGridMailgunMailchimp/Mandrill 作为外部提供商。在初始设置步骤中选择您的提供商即可。

如果 DNS 记录不匹配会怎样?

从未认证域名发送的邮件更容易被收件箱提供商拒绝或过滤至垃圾邮件。请在 OneSignal 仪表板中验证您的 DNS 记录——警告图标表示存在需要解决的不匹配问题。